Transaction 58ebdcb71340169cf95bacb5b8e81b688c601d64bba746edeeebac4aee5372ad
1 Input
1 Output
-
58ebdcb71340169cf95bacb5b8e81b688c601d64bba746edeeebac4aee5372ad:0
- value
- 990100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d5b025e6923d7ff2f2092fc2aab316bc624a186 OP_EQUAL
- address
- 3G3336TUCAN7FkExZL5goLVMpn9vE3KZdB